ETF Systems - Full Stack Engineer - Associate

Blackrock

Actively hiring
San Francisco, US Posted 74 days ago $132,500$162,000 / year

At a glance

AI generated

TL;DR

Join the ETF Systems Development team as a mid-level Angular developer, contributing to the development of our next-generation single-page web application for ETF trading. You will collaborate with UX designers and backend engineers to create intuitive user interfaces and robust APIs, ensuring high-quality code through unit tests and automated integration tests. Your role involves participating in agile delivery processes, providing technical input on system design, and working closely with product and quality assurance teams to estimate scope, perform demos, and validate releases. You will also support production systems by addressing issues quickly and effectively. The ideal candidate has 3+ years of experience with Angular 17 and ngRx, expertise in API-First principles, familiarity with AI-augmented workflows, and a strong background in software engineering tools like Maven and unit testing frameworks. This role offers significant opportunities for impact within the ETF business area at Blackrock, a leader in financial technology.

Skills

Angular ngRx REST Java Python Git Splunk Snowflake SQL maven unit testing integration testing mocking frameworks CI/CD Kubernetes Docker AWS PostgreSQL Jenkins GitHub Swagger Terraform

What you'll do

  • Develop next generation ETF platform using Angular 17 and ngRx.
  • Design intuitive user interfaces based on UX designer inputs for ETF trading.
  • Write high-quality code, unit tests, and automated integration tests for sprint tasks.
  • Provide technical input in team discussions on system design and implementation.
  • Collaborate with backend engineers to create data contracts and APIs for new features.
  • Work closely with product teams to translate high-level vision into functional requirements.
  • Design testing strategies and validate releases before deployment with QA team.

What we're looking for

  • 3+ years of experience developing web applications using Angular 17 and ngRx.
  • Proficient in API design with REST or gRPC, and modern object-oriented languages like Java or Python.
  • Strong analytical skills and ability to quickly learn new concepts.
  • Experience with Git, code collaboration tools, and providing production support.
  • Familiarity with relational databases, SQL, and AI-augmented workflows for code generation and improvement.
  • Demonstrable experience using software engineering tools such as Maven, unit testing, integration testing, and mocking frameworks.

Market check

Salary context

This $132,500–$162,000 range sits above 28% of similar postings on FindRole.

Peer median band

$154,080$220,000

Median floor and ceiling across peers.

Typical midpoint (25–75%)

$144,781$221,062

Middle half of comparable postings.

Based on 240 comparable postings.

* 240 is the maximum number of comparable postings sampled.

Employer

About Blackrock

BlackRock is the world''s largest asset management firm, providing investment management, risk management, and advisory services to institutional and retail clients through its Aladdin technology platform. Industry: Asset Management & Financial Services

Blackrock currently has 104 open roles on FindRole.

Listed pay typically runs $140,000–$195,000 across 101 roles with salary data.

Most-posted roles

View all roles at Blackrock

More like this

Similar roles

ETF Systems - Full Stack Engineer - Associate

Blackrock

San Francisco, US 83 days ago $132,500$162,000
Angular ngRx REST Java Python Git Splunk Snowflake SQL maven unit testing integration testing mocking frameworks CI/CD Kubernetes Docker AWS PostgreSQL Jenkins GitHub Swagger Terraform

ETF Systems - Full Stack Engineer - Associate

Blackrock

San Francisco, US 55 days ago $132,500$162,000
Angular ngRx REST Java Python Git Splunk Snowflake SQL maven unit testing integration testing mocking frameworks CI/CD Kubernetes Docker AWS Azure Google Cloud Platform PostgreSQL MongoDB Terraform

Application Engineer (ETF)-Java Backend -Associate

Blackrock

Atlanta, US 21 days ago $120,000$148,000
Java Python Kafka gRPC SQL Server Apache Cassandra Azure DevOps Agile Scrum Kubernetes Docker AWS Azure GCP CI/CD AI workflows code generation Redis Ignite

US ETF Platform – ETF Product Developer, Associate

Blackrock

San Francisco, US 9 days ago $110,000$150,000
Python SQL ETFs Project Management CI/CD AWS Kubernetes Docker Git Jira Confluence PostgreSQL MongoDB Excel PowerPoint Agile Scrum Regulatory Compliance

Managing Director, Head of US ETF Platform

Blackrock

San Francisco, US 14 days ago $270,000$350,000
ETFs investment management trading market structure team leadership stakeholder management platform innovation Risk Management data technology ETF mechanics primary/secondary markets regulatory environments hybrid work model CI/CD